What is Auracast™ and why does it change everything?
Auracast™ belongs to the next generation of Bluetooth®, fundamentally changing how you interact with the devices around you. It replaces the traditional pairing with a seamless connection — and lets a single source broadcast to unlimited listeners at higher quality and even lower latency than classic Bluetooth®.

Technical Benchmarks
Higher fidelity. Lower power. Open spec.
Auracast™ rides on the LC3 codec — the mandatory codec for Bluetooth® LE Audio — delivering broadcast-grade audio that outperforms classic Bluetooth® on every meaningful axis.
48 kHz
Full-band stereo
True full-band sample rate at bitrates from 24 to 124 kbps.
LC3
Mandatory codec
Better quality than SBC at half the bitrate — and far less power.
PBP
Public Broadcast Profile
The spec layer that lets any compliant Sink discover and join public Auracast™ streams in venues.

Frequently asked
Auracast™, in plain language.
Auracast™ is a Bluetooth® broadcast feature that lets a single audio source stream to an unlimited number of nearby receivers— headphones, speakers, hearing aids—at the same time, in sync.
Classic Bluetooth® is point-to-point: one source pairs to one sink. Auracast™ is point-to-multipoint: one source broadcasts to unlimited sinks with no pairing handshake per listener. Auracast™ operates on a fraction of power with a higher fidelity sound.
Native support is rolling out across newer Android phones (Samsung Galaxy S24/S25, Pixel 9), select TVs, hearing aids, and earbuds shipping with Bluetooth® 5.2+ and LE Audio firmware. LC3 (Low Complexity Communication Codec) is the mandatory codec for Bluetooth® LE Audio. It supports 48 kHz full-band audio at lower bitrates than SBC, with better quality, lower latency, and significantly reduced power consumption—enabling longer battery life on hearing aids, earbuds, and broadcast transmitters like splitR.
